The journey from Oudtshoorn to the border town of Musina is a massive 1800 km trek. You will travel the entire length of the N1 highway. This route is the main artery for trade between South Africa and Zimbabwe. Expect a multi-day journey with at least one or two overnight stops.

Total Distance: 1800 km driving distance, 1300 km straight-line air distance.
